April 06, 2022Life is Like...a Menu?!

I don’t know why I don’t weigh 400 lbs. Good genes and pure blind luck, I suppose, because I do love to eat!

When dining out, I naturally have favorite places to eat ... if you’re ever down my way, stop by and I’ll take you to eat at the Broadway Diner.

Come hungry, because they are super generous with their portion sizes.

If you are a dessert lover, you’re really in for a treat ... they have a dessert case filled with homemade cakes and pies. The strawberry cheesecake is my personal favorite. Come planning to eat dessert only, or a dinner with carry-out dessert ... you will not be able to eat a Broadway dinner and follow up with dessert at one sitting. Trust me.

It’s fun to take folks there on their first visit, just to see their initial reaction to that menu ... 12 laminated, legal-size pages of over 500 items – well, 11 pages, if you don’t count the cover – we lovingly call it the War and Peace of menus. You can have any kind of breakfast all day as well as chops, steaks, burgers, ribs, fish, shrimp, chicken, wings, salads, Italian, Greek, Mexican, sandwiches, wraps, and soups, as well as any of the 4-5 daily specials with soup or veggies of the day.

On my first visit I was a bit skeptical that they could handle that kind of variety and still be good ... but they do it! You can go there many times and not get bored.

So why, of all things, am I talking about a restaurant menu?

Because I’m in a rut.

At the Broadway Diner, there are probably 20-30 items on the menu that I really like, yet I tend to always order the same 2-3 things over and over. And I do the same when I’m drawing.

In The Meek and the Mighty articles I show how to plan and draw characters, starting off with simple stick figures. In Part 3 I show how to, beginning with the stick figures, layout a scene with multiple and various characters. In the process I realized that I seem to draw the same basic character over and over.

Different characters, for sure ... young and old, guys and gals ... but they all have the same basic body build, the same basic clothing styles, simple hair styles, etc. Especially on the drawings I do for my social media posts.

It’s time to up my game a bit ...
